 Host Jeanne Benedict demonstrates how to throw the perfect High-School Basketball Team Reunion party in this week's Weekend Entertaining episode.
|
In this episode show host Jeanne Benedict will help Frank (the party host) reunite his regional champion high school basketball team 30 years after they won the title. Frank and Jeanne create a mural that mimics the original team photo. Jeanne and Frank's wife, Ruth Ann, create a two-sided buffet that mimics the look of a basketball court, complete with a "hardwood" floor and a basketball goal. The food will be served in bowls painted to look like basketballs. As for the menu, southern comfort food is the name of the game, served on cafeteria-style plastic trays complete with separate compartments. Chicken-n-Dumplings will be the main course and cafeteria classic- macaroni and cheese gets a new twist, reinvented as an appetizer. Crispy lightly breaded macaroni and cheese balls complete with a creamy marinara dipping sauce should score plenty of points with guests. While the gentleman congregate and talk about old times, the ladies can spend some time creating shadowboxes complete with copies of old photos of the team.
This party is rated 4 on a scale of 1 to 5, with 5 being the most difficult, and is geared toward the skills of a frequent entertainer.
Hourly Breakdown
Basketball Party Themed Invitations -- 1 hour to make 15
Team Photo Mural -- 4 hours
Buffet Sign -- 2 hours
Gymnasium Buffet Floor -- 2 hours
Basketball Bowls -- 1 hour to make 2
Food Preparation -- 5 hours
Total Prep Time -- 15 hours
